  1. IVF Success Rate In India By Age IVF Success Rate In First Attempt The age of the female partner has a substantial impact on the in vitro fertilization (IVF) success rate in India. Because of their superior ovarian reserve and egg quality, women under 35 have the highest success rates, achieving between 50 and 60 percent of cycles. As egg quality and quantity start to deteriorate, the success rate for women between the ages of 35 and 37 marginally decreases to roughly 40 50%. The success rate drops to about 30 40% per cycle for women between the ages of 38 and 40. Even with sophisticated methods, the success rate drops dramatically after the age of 40 to roughly 10 20%, and for women over 45, it can drop as low as 5 10%. Given that donor eggs are usually obtained from younger, healthy donors, their availability can boost older women s success rates. IVF success rate in India by age, however, are also greatly influenced by elements including the clinic s caliber, the doctors skill, and the couple s general health.

  2. Does IVF Have A 100% Success Rate? The success rate of IVF is not 100%. The age of the woman, the quality of the sperm and eggs, the underlying cause of infertility, and the general health of the person or couple receiving treatment are some of the variables that affect the effectiveness of IVF. For women under 35, the typical IVF cycle success rate is between 50 and 60 percent, and it progressively declines with age. The success rate falls to roughly 10 20% for women over 40. Although results have improved due to technological and methodological breakthroughs, there are no assurances. Every IVF cycle has a chance of failing because of things like poor embryo implantation, genetic abnormalities, or problems with the uterus. Signs Of Poor Egg Quality

  3. A womans fertility and the likelihood of a successful pregnancy can be greatly impacted by poor egg quality. Among the typical symptoms are irregular menstrual periods, which could be a sign of ovulation-affecting hormone abnormalities. Despite consistent attempts, women with low-quality eggs may have trouble getting pregnant; this condition is frequently referred to as unexplained infertility. Low ovarian reserve, as demonstrated by tests such as antral follicle count (AFC) or anti-M llerian hormone (AMH) levels, can also be an indicator. Poor egg quality during IVF can also result in sluggish embryo growth, low fertilization rates, or embryos with chromosomal abnormalities, which can cause miscarriage or unsuccessful implantation. Given that egg quality tends to deteriorate after the age of 35, age is a significant influence. Decreased egg quality may also result from lifestyle choices including smoking, binge drinking, stress, or inadequate diet. This problem can be resolved by speaking with a reproductive doctor and adopting preventative measures including dietary adjustments, supplements, or fertility treatments. Pregnancy risks often rise sharply after the age of 35, while the age at which having a child is deemed less safe varies depending on personal health. Fertility starts to fall in the late 20s to early 30s, and it sharply declines after the age of 35. Women are born with a limited amount of eggs. The likelihood of a natural conception decreases significantly around the age of 40 and beyond, and the risk of difficulties including miscarriage, preterm birth, chromosomal abnormalities (such Down syndrome), and maternal health conditions like gestational diabetes or hypertension increases significantly. IVF and other assisted reproductive technologies can help women in their 40s and even early 50s conceive, but these pregnancies frequently need more medical supervision. Pregnancy is generally not advised after the age of 50 because of the substantial health hazards to the mother and unborn child, which include cardiovascular strain, problems during cesarean birth, and developmental issues for the child. Preconception Health Check-Up To detect any possible hereditary concerns, both partners should have medical examinations before becoming pregnant. Making decisions and determining the probability of inherited chromosomal abnormalities can be aided by genetic counseling. Maternal Age Consideration Women may think about having children earlier in life if at all possible, as the likelihood of chromosomal disorders, such as Down syndrome, rises with maternal age. The risk factor for these illnesses is higher in mothers who are older than 35. Healthy Lifestyle It s important to keep up a healthy lifestyle. This includes controlling any preexisting medical disorders like diabetes or hypertension, limiting alcohol and tobacco use, eating a balanced diet high in folic acid, and lowering stress. Prenatal Testing Chromosome abnormalities can be found using early prenatal screenings such ultrasounds and non-invasive prenatal testing (NIPT). Although there is a slight chance of difficulties, diagnostic procedures like amniocentesis or chorionic villus sampling (CVS) can validate the results. Preimplantation genetic testing (PGT) can screen embryos for chromosomal abnormalities before implantation, allowing only healthy embryos to be transferred for couples undergoing assisted reproductive technologies (ART). Knowing IVF And How Successful It Eggs are taken from a woman s ovaries, fertilized with sperm in a lab, and the resulting embryos are then placed in the uterus as part of the IVF procedure. The clinical pregnancy rate per embryo transfer, which represents the proportion of transfers that result in a pregnancy, is commonly used to gauge the success of IVF. The woman s age, ovarian reserve, sperm and egg quality, number of embryos transplanted, and existence of any underlying medical issues are some of the factors that affect IVF success rates in India. What Are The Role Of Donor Eggs In IVF Treatment In India? IVF Success Rate In India By Age Using donor eggs can significantly increase the likelihood that IVF will be successful for women over 40. Usually obtained from younger, more fertile women, donor eggs are of greater quality for fertilization. This method can result in success rates similar to those of younger women while avoiding the age-related drop in egg quality. About 65 70% of donor eggs are successful. Considerations: Before choosing donor eggs, a fertility doctor should be consulted in detail regarding the emotional, ethical, and legal implications.
